在数字化转型的浪潮中,企业对数据的依赖程度日益增加。数据中台、数字孪生和数字可视化等技术逐渐成为企业提升竞争力的重要手段。然而,如何高效地管理和监控这些技术所产生的指标,成为一个关键问题。低代码指标管理系统作为一种新兴的解决方案,为企业提供了更灵活、更高效的指标管理方式。本文将深入探讨低代码指标管理系统的构建与实现,帮助企业更好地利用数据驱动决策。
什么是低代码指标管理系统?
低代码指标管理系统是一种基于低代码开发平台构建的系统,用于企业对各类业务指标的定义、监控、分析和可视化展示。与传统的系统开发方式相比,低代码开发通过可视化界面和预设模板,大幅降低了开发门槛,缩短了开发周期。
核心功能
- 指标定义与管理:支持用户自定义指标,包括指标名称、计算公式、数据来源等。
- 数据集成:能够与企业现有的数据源(如数据库、API、第三方系统)无缝对接,确保数据的实时性和准确性。
- 监控与告警:对关键指标进行实时监控,并在指标异常时触发告警,帮助企业在第一时间发现问题。
- 可视化展示:通过图表、仪表盘等形式,将复杂的指标数据以直观的方式呈现,便于决策者快速理解。
- 权限管理:支持多角色权限分配,确保数据的安全性和隐私性。
低代码指标管理系统的构建方法
1. 明确需求
在构建低代码指标管理系统之前,企业需要明确自身的具体需求。这包括:
- 指标类型:是关注财务指标、运营指标,还是用户行为指标?
- 数据来源:数据将来自哪些系统或平台?
- 用户角色:系统将有哪些用户角色?每个角色需要哪些功能?
- 展示方式:是否需要特定的可视化形式(如柱状图、折线图、地图等)?
2. 选择低代码开发平台
选择一个适合的低代码开发平台是构建系统的基石。目前市面上有许多低代码平台可供选择,如OutSystems、Mendix、Bizagi等。在选择时,需要考虑以下因素:
- 功能丰富性:平台是否支持指标定义、数据集成、可视化展示等功能?
- 易用性:平台的界面是否直观,是否支持快速开发?
- 扩展性:平台是否支持未来的功能扩展和二次开发?
- 成本:平台的 licensing 成本是否在企业的预算范围内?
3. 设计系统架构
在确定了平台和需求后,需要设计系统的整体架构。通常,低代码指标管理系统的架构可以分为以下几个层次:
- 数据层:负责数据的存储和管理,包括数据库、数据仓库等。
- 业务逻辑层:负责指标的计算、数据的处理和业务规则的执行。
- 表现层:负责数据的可视化展示,包括仪表盘、图表等。
- 用户界面层:负责与用户的交互,包括指标的定义、监控、告警等功能。
4. 开发与部署
利用低代码平台,开发者可以通过可视化界面快速搭建系统。具体步骤如下:
- 创建项目:在低代码平台上创建一个新的项目。
- 设计界面:通过拖放的方式设计系统的用户界面,包括指标管理页面、监控页面、可视化页面等。
- 配置数据源:将系统与数据源对接,配置数据接口和数据格式。
- 定义指标:在平台上自定义指标,包括指标名称、计算公式、数据来源等。
- 设置监控与告警:配置监控规则和告警条件,确保指标异常时能够及时通知相关人员。
- 部署系统:将开发好的系统部署到生产环境,确保系统的稳定性和可用性。
低代码指标管理系统的实现步骤
1. 数据集成
数据集成是低代码指标管理系统的核心步骤之一。企业需要将分散在各个系统中的数据整合到一个统一的平台中。这可以通过以下方式实现:
- API对接:通过API接口将数据从第三方系统传输到低代码平台。
- 数据库同步:通过数据库同步工具将数据从数据库传输到低代码平台。
- 文件导入:将数据以文件形式(如Excel、CSV)导入到低代码平台。
2. 指标定义
在数据集成完成后,企业需要对指标进行定义。这包括:
- 指标分类:将指标分为财务指标、运营指标、用户行为指标等。
- 指标计算:定义指标的计算公式,例如“转化率 = 成功转化次数 / 总访问次数”。
- 指标权重:根据指标的重要性,设置不同的权重,以便在数据分析时进行加权计算。
3. 监控与告警
为了确保指标的实时性和准确性,企业需要对指标进行实时监控,并在指标异常时触发告警。具体步骤如下:
- 设置监控规则:根据指标的正常范围和阈值,设置监控规则。
- 配置告警方式:选择告警方式,如邮件告警、短信告警、微信告警等。
- 测试告警功能:在测试环境中测试告警功能,确保告警信息能够及时准确地发送到相关人员。
4. 可视化展示
可视化展示是低代码指标管理系统的重要组成部分。通过图表、仪表盘等形式,企业可以直观地了解指标的动态变化。常见的可视化形式包括:
- 柱状图:用于展示不同指标的对比。
- 折线图:用于展示指标的 trends。
- 饼图:用于展示指标的构成比例。
- 仪表盘:将多个指标集中展示在一个界面上,便于用户快速了解整体情况。
5. 权限管理
为了确保数据的安全性和隐私性,企业需要对系统进行权限管理。具体步骤如下:
- 角色划分:根据用户的角色和职责,划分不同的权限组。
- 权限分配:为每个权限组分配相应的权限,例如查看权限、编辑权限、删除权限等。
- 权限测试:在测试环境中测试权限管理功能,确保权限分配正确无误。
低代码指标管理系统的应用场景
1. 数据中台
数据中台是企业数字化转型的核心基础设施。通过低代码指标管理系统,企业可以将数据中台中的各项指标进行统一管理,从而更好地支持业务决策。
2. 数字孪生
数字孪生是一种通过数字化手段对物理世界进行模拟的技术。通过低代码指标管理系统,企业可以对数字孪生模型中的各项指标进行实时监控和分析,从而优化模型的性能。
3. 数字可视化
数字可视化是将数据以直观的方式展示出来的一种技术。通过低代码指标管理系统,企业可以快速搭建数字可视化平台,将复杂的指标数据以图表、仪表盘等形式展示出来,便于用户理解和分析。
低代码指标管理系统的优缺点
优点
- 开发周期短:低代码开发平台通过可视化界面和预设模板,大幅缩短了开发周期。
- 灵活性高:低代码系统可以根据企业的具体需求进行快速调整和扩展。
- 成本低:低代码开发平台的使用成本较低,尤其是对于中小企业来说,是一个非常经济的选择。
- 易于维护:低代码系统的维护成本较低,且易于升级和优化。
缺点
- 功能受限:低代码平台的功能可能不如传统开发方式灵活,对于复杂需求可能需要额外的开发工作。
- 性能瓶颈:低代码系统在处理大规模数据时可能会遇到性能瓶颈,需要额外的优化和调整。
- 学习曲线:低代码平台的学习曲线较高,需要一定的培训和学习才能熟练使用。
低代码指标管理系统的未来发展趋势
随着企业对数据的依赖程度不断提高,低代码指标管理系统将会迎来更广阔的发展空间。未来,低代码指标管理系统将朝着以下几个方向发展:
- 智能化:通过人工智能和机器学习技术,实现指标的自动分析和预测。
- 实时化:通过实时数据处理技术,实现指标的实时监控和分析。
- 移动化:通过移动应用技术,实现指标管理的移动化,便于用户随时随地查看和分析指标。
- 集成化:通过与更多第三方系统的集成,实现数据的无缝对接和共享。
结语
低代码指标管理系统作为一种新兴的解决方案,为企业提供了更灵活、更高效的指标管理方式。通过低代码开发平台,企业可以快速搭建适合自己业务需求的指标管理系统,从而更好地利用数据驱动决策。如果您对低代码指标管理系统感兴趣,可以申请试用我们的产品,体验其强大的功能和便捷的操作。申请试用
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。